Transaction fc50740608fb5120969879ddbb4328dc2294e0724944972b3c8642d897ae9daa
1 Input
1 Output
-
fc50740608fb5120969879ddbb4328dc2294e0724944972b3c8642d897ae9daa:0
- value
- 109482989
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62addc2701dfaadadf8964718a7e837d2ebd6529 OP_EQUAL
- address
- 3AgnRLzzSiVcJJnTw9s4d5QXdmiHjL5oSY